2022年,VHF航空地面通讯站的全球市场规模估值为11.8亿美元,从2023年的12.7亿美元成长到2031年的22.4亿美元,预测期内(2024-2024年)复合年增长率预计为7.4% 2031)。

VHF航空地面通讯站的全球市场是飞机通讯必不可少的大型通讯设备业务的重要组成部分。甚高频空中地面通讯站是飞机和地面人员之间可靠、安全通讯的基础。增强全球航空旅行的安全和秩序并实现简单且高效的飞机控制是该领域的主要目标。这一市场扩张背后的主要因素是航空工程的上升趋势,这可能会导致采用率下降。

对先进和整合甚高频飞机地面通讯站的需求推动了创新和市场开拓机会。此外,该领域还可以受益于对通讯技术的更多关注,这些技术可以提高飞行过程中的效率和情境察觉。总之,由于航空业需求的变化和技术的进步,甚高频飞机和地面通讯站的全球市场预计将会成长。同时,市场必须克服障碍才能利用新的成长机会。

Global VHF Air Ground Communication Stations Market size was valued at USD 1.18 billion in 2022 and is poised to grow from USD 1.27 billion in 2023 to USD 2.24 billion by 2031, growing at a CAGR of 7.4% in the forecast period (2024-2031).

A significant part of the larger Communication Equipment business, which is crucial to aircraft communication, is the global market for VHF air ground communication stations. The foundation of dependable and secure communication between aircraft and ground workers is made up of VHF aircraft ground stations. Enhancing global air travel safety and orderliness to enable simple and efficient aircraft control is the primary goal of this sector. The primary driver of this market's expansion is the possibility that rising trends in aviation engineering will make them less widely adopted.

Opportunities for innovation and market development are presented by the requirement for sophisticated and integrated VHF aircraft ground communication stations. Moreover, the sector stands to gain from a greater focus on communication technologies that facilitate efficiency and situational awareness during flight. In conclusion, the worldwide market for VHF aircraft and ground communication stations is expected to rise due to the airline industry's changing demands and technical improvements. At the same time, the market will need to overcome obstacles in order to take advantage of new chances for growth.

Global VHF Air Ground Communication Stations Market Segmental Analysis

The global VHF air ground communication stations market is segmented based on airport class, airport type, airport categories, application, and region. By airport class, the market is segmented into Class A, Class B, Class C, and Class D. By Type, the market is segmented into Portable and Fixed. By Airport categories, it is segmented into Commercial Service Airports, Cargo Service Airports, Reliever Airports, and General Aviation Airports. By Application, the market is segmented into Commercial and Military. By region, the market is segmented into North America, Europe, Asia Pacific, Middle East and Africa, and Latin America.

Drivers of the Global VHF Air Ground Communication Stations Market

One of the main reasons influencing the growth of the global market for VHF air ground communication stations is the enormous demand for air travel. In order to ensure that pilots are in contact with air traffic controllers, there is a rising need for efficient and trustworthy air-ground communication connections due to the growing number of aircraft arriving.

Restraints in the Global VHF Air Ground Communication Stations Market

Given the nature of the aviation business, makers of VHF air ground communication stations may have difficulties relating to strict regulatory standards and certifications. The complexity or cost of creating and implementing such communication systems may rise if many international aviation bodies and standards are followed.

Market Trends of the Global VHF Air Ground Communication Stations Market

Artificial intelligence (AI) integration: One noteworthy development is the incorporation of AI into airborne ground communication systems. AI technologies have the potential to boost communication efficiency, automate some tasks, and facilitate predictive maintenance, all of which will enhance an aviation system's dependability and performance.
